GutHookScript
=============
**Inherits:** `RefCounted <https://docs.godotengine.org/en/stable/classes/class_refcounted.html>`_
This script is the base for custom scripts to be used in pre and post run hooks.
.. rst-class:: classref-introduction-group
Description
-----------
GUT Wiki: `https://gut.readthedocs.io <https://gut.readthedocs.io>`__
Creating a hook script requires that you:
- Inherit ``GutHookScript``\
- Implement a ``run()`` method
- Configure the path in GUT (gutconfig and/or editor) as the approparite hook (pre or post).

Property Descriptions
---------------------
.. _class_GutHookScript_property_JunitXmlExport:
.. rst-class:: classref-property
`Variant <https://docs.godotengine.org/en/stable/classes/class_variant.html>`_ **JunitXmlExport** = ``load(...)`` :ref:`🔗<class_GutHookScript_property_JunitXmlExport>`
Class responsible for generating xml. You could use this to generate XML yourself instead of using the built in GUT xml generation options. See :ref:`addons/gut/junit_xml_export.gd<class_addons/gut/junit_xml_export.gd>`
.. rst-class:: classref-item-separator
----
.. _class_GutHookScript_property_gut:
.. rst-class:: classref-property
`Variant <https://docs.godotengine.org/en/stable/classes/class_variant.html>`_ **gut** = ``null`` :ref:`🔗<class_GutHookScript_property_gut>`
This is the instance of :ref:`GutMain<class_GutMain>` that is running the tests. You can get information about the run from this object. This is set by GUT when the script is instantiated.

Method Descriptions
-------------------
.. _class_GutHookScript_method_run:
.. rst-class:: classref-method
|void| **run**\ (\ ) :ref:`🔗<class_GutHookScript_method_run>`
Virtual method that will be called by GUT after instantiating this script. This is where you put all of your logic.
.. rst-class:: classref-item-separator
----
.. _class_GutHookScript_method_register_inner_classes:
.. rst-class:: classref-method
|void| **register_inner_classes**\ (\ script\: `Script <https://docs.godotengine.org/en/stable/classes/class_script.html>`_\ ) :ref:`🔗<class_GutHookScript_method_register_inner_classes>`
Register inner classes from one or more scripts for doubling. Only worth calling from pre-run hook, not post-run.
.. rst-class:: classref-item-separator
----
.. _class_GutHookScript_method_set_exit_code:
.. rst-class:: classref-method
|void| **set_exit_code**\ (\ code\: `int <https://docs.godotengine.org/en/stable/classes/class_int.html>`_\ ) :ref:`🔗<class_GutHookScript_method_set_exit_code>`
Set the exit code when running from the command line. If not set then the default exit code will be returned (0 when no tests fail, 1 when any tests fail).
.. rst-class:: classref-item-separator
----
.. _class_GutHookScript_method_get_exit_code:
.. rst-class:: classref-method
`Variant <https://docs.godotengine.org/en/stable/classes/class_variant.html>`_ **get_exit_code**\ (\ ) :ref:`🔗<class_GutHookScript_method_get_exit_code>`
Returns the exit code set with ``set_exit_code``
.. rst-class:: classref-item-separator
----
.. _class_GutHookScript_method_abort:
.. rst-class:: classref-method
|void| **abort**\ (\ ) :ref:`🔗<class_GutHookScript_method_abort>`
Usable by pre-run script to cause the run to end AFTER the run() method finishes. GUT will quit and post-run script will not be ran.
.. rst-class:: classref-item-separator
----
.. _class_GutHookScript_method_should_abort:
.. rst-class:: classref-method
`Variant <https://docs.godotengine.org/en/stable/classes/class_variant.html>`_ **should_abort**\ (\ ) :ref:`🔗<class_GutHookScript_method_should_abort>`
Returns if ``abort`` was called.
